Further than Descartes’ rule of signs
The sign pattern defined by the real polynomial $Q:=\Sigma _{j=0}^da_jx^j$, $a_j\ne 0$, is the string $\sigma (Q):=(\mathrm{sgn}(a_d),\ldots ,\mathrm{sgn}(a_0))$.
